(Getty Images) "Too Little, Too Late" Israel has accused Hamas of using rape as a weapon of war, and activists are calling out what they say is an unacceptable lack of international uproar. Weâve got more on [the explosive claims at the center of this debate](, plus takeaways from a charged U.N. panel. Harrowing details: After interviewing hundreds of survivors, reviewing footage, and examining the bodies of victims, Israeli police have determined that âhorrifyingâ acts of sexual violence were committed at a large scale on Oct. 7, according to a high-ranking officer at the U.N. panel. Hamas has denied this. Backlash: Israeli officials and many Jewish activists have faulted womenâs rights groups and humanitarian agencies for not speaking out sooner about these allegations. U.N. Women, one of the groups under the microscope, did issue a rebuke of Hamas last week, but Israelâs ambassador to the U.N. called it âtoo little, too late.â Speaking out: The U.N. panel featured Sheryl Sandberg, Sen. Kirsten Gillibrand, and Israeli security forces. They shared witness accounts of rape and genital mutilation, and expressed grave disappointment with the global response. âSilence is complicity, and in the face of terror, we cannot be quiet,â Sandberg said.

Addressing a Fox News town hall last night, Donald Trump refused to confirm whether he'd abuse power if he reclaims the White House. âDo you have any plans... to abuse power, to break the law, to use the government to go after people?â moderator Sean Hannity asked. Trump initially sidestepped the question, but when pressed, replied: âExcept for day one." President Biden meanwhile has drawn fire for admitting he's "not sure" he'd be running in 2024 if Trump wasn't also making a bid. Breaking: A suspect is in custody after a spate of shootings in Texas yesterday left six people dead and three wounded. The male suspect, who's yet to be named, has been charged with capital murder, with further charges expected in due course. Two of those injured were police officers. Austin police stressed last night that they weren't aware the attacks were connected until the suspect was taken into custody. Resolution reached: SAG-AFTRA, the union representing actors in their negotiations with Hollywood studios, has ratified a new contract. The deal, sealed by a member vote of 78% to 22%, marks the end of a four-month strike that's paralyzed the entertainment industry. It includes a pay rise, plus protections around the use of AI. Union president Fran Drescher said she was "proud" of members for "locking in the gains" of their 118-day strike. Emergency measures: A pregnant woman from Texas may be the first adult to ask a court to authorize an abortion since Roe v Wade was overturned. Per the filing, Kate Cox, 31, is 20 weeks pregnant and has recently learned of a lethal fetal diagnosis that means carrying the baby to term could kill her. Cox has been to three emergency rooms in the last month "due to severe cramping and unidentifiable fluid leaks,â the suit says.
